{-# LANGUAGE PatternSynonyms #-}
module Graphics.GL.APPLE.VertexProgramEvaluators (
glGetAPPLEVertexProgramEvaluators,
gl_APPLE_vertex_program_evaluators,
pattern GL_VERTEX_ATTRIB_MAP1_APPLE,
pattern GL_VERTEX_ATTRIB_MAP1_COEFF_APPLE,
pattern GL_VERTEX_ATTRIB_MAP1_DOMAIN_APPLE,
pattern GL_VERTEX_ATTRIB_MAP1_ORDER_APPLE,
pattern GL_VERTEX_ATTRIB_MAP1_SIZE_APPLE,
pattern GL_VERTEX_ATTRIB_MAP2_APPLE,
pattern GL_VERTEX_ATTRIB_MAP2_COEFF_APPLE,
pattern GL_VERTEX_ATTRIB_MAP2_DOMAIN_APPLE,
pattern GL_VERTEX_ATTRIB_MAP2_ORDER_APPLE,
pattern GL_VERTEX_ATTRIB_MAP2_SIZE_APPLE,
glDisableVertexAttribAPPLE,
glEnableVertexAttribAPPLE,
glIsVertexAttribEnabledAPPLE,
glMapVertexAttrib1dAPPLE,
glMapVertexAttrib1fAPPLE,
glMapVertexAttrib2dAPPLE,
glMapVertexAttrib2fAPPLE
) where
import Graphics.GL.ExtensionPredicates
import Graphics.GL.Tokens
import Graphics.GL.Functions